Being able to act upon a seller's feedback would likely slow the system down, as well as open up that slippery slope of allowing the buyer to protect themselves, but also the potential for users to blacklist groups that shouldn't be acted against (read: new users).  Still, something would be nice to protect against shoddy users.

Perhaps being able to set a value (as a buyer) that states 'If seller's Neutral/Negative percentage is greater than 25%/50%/75%/etc, then skip me as a potential match" would help.  This would lend a little bit of weight to the otherwise fruitless neutral/negative feedback option, while also avoiding the potential abuse from some overcautious members by 'blacklisting' new members, who ideally wouldn't have a large (if any) negative feedback percentage.  In addition, the use of such an option would be at the loss of the enacter, as he would be skipped by this 'negative' user in favor or the next active buyer, a small price to pay for peace of mind I suppose, but those that don't want to use the option may push ahead a little bit in the queue at a little bit higher of a risk.

Granted, I have no idea what that would entail coding wise; surely something not easy, but it could potentially slowly bring the quality of trades up from usually stellar to almost always stellar.

And then the feedback would be disputed and eventually changed to a neutral. Unless goozex changes the rules, receiving the wrong game condition is a neutral feedback, not negative. Negative is generally only acceptable if you don't get a game or get the wrong game altogether.
